February 18, 1775: British watercolourist and etcher Thomas Girtin is born.

At a time when oil painting was the norm, Girtin helped to establish watercolour as a reputable and desirable medium.

900 YEARS OF READING ABBEY. Gateway was home to Reading Abbey Girls’ School, c.1755-1794.

Two former pupils found success in the world of literature; Mary Martha Sherwood (1775-1851) and Jane Austen (1775-1817).
